Notable Blended Genre Films and Their Cultural Significance
Several prominent blended genre films illustrate the impact of cultural elements on storytelling techniques. For instance, 'Crouching Tiger, Hidden Dragon' uniquely combines martial arts with romance and drama, showcasing rich Chinese cultural motifs while captivating a global audience. The storytelling techniques employed, such as visual metaphors and poetic narratives, embody traditional Eastern storytelling while resonating with Western viewers through dynamic action and deep emotional engagement.
